The ATE PWR-wireless module is very compact and lightweight. It includes the conditioning for 4 type K thermocouples or 2 extensometry gauges. Data is transmitted using frequency modulation (PCM) wireless. It is battery (3.6V) or an inductive loop. Data can be recovered in analogue output format or CAN2B or USB3 format or IENA. Applications are multiple (distorsion or temperature measurement on transmission shafts, rotating machinery, in the automotive, aeronautical or industrial sectors).

> 2 channel stress gauge or 4 channel type K thermocouple input
> Battery powered, lithium battery powered or self powered by induction
> Maximum temperature -40°C + 125°C (-20°C +85 °C for battery powered) 210 °C bespoke high temperature measurement option
> Maximum acceleration 10,000G (40,000 G option)
> Bandwidth up to 100 000 ech/s, 1 channel
> Size: 42.7 x 20.6 x 12 mm
> Gain and offset programmable by USB 2 ( soft PC ) or remotely using radio transmission
> Digital PCM radio transmission
> IP65 anodised aluminium case
> Radio receiver output 0-5V analogue and USB 2 (CAN2B option available) and IENA

There is also a bespoke broadband, high temperature (+200°C) line for all specific applications.
